AI's Product Pivot: From Assistants to Undercurrents
The product world is grappling with AI's expanding role, moving beyond flashy demos to seamlessly integrated experiences. Duolingo is going "AI-first," betting big on the tech's transformative power. Yet, questions loom about AI's impact on essential human skills and ethical considerations. We are at an inflection point, where strategic use of AI could lead to market dominance or over-reliance could lead to poor designs and unaddressed user needs.
Product teams are experimenting with AI-generated personas for UX research. But experts warn that AI lacks emotional depth and real-world intuition, potentially leading to flawed insights. Companies such as Attio are embedding AI directly into core functionalities rather than tacking it on as an assistant, improving workflows and user experience. Lenny's Newsletter explores how a former NYT columnist is using AI to enhance their writing process, while also noting how AI tools could atrophy important skills. Monday.com highlights that impact is more important than just shipping features. Product managers are also encouraged to think critically about the problem AI should solve for users and democratize experimentation by empowering teams across an organization to experiment with the technology.
Why it matters: AI is no longer a future trend; it's reshaping product development now. Product leaders must strategically integrate AI while safeguarding human insight and ethical considerations. It's about finding the right balance between AI's capabilities and the irreplaceable value of human ingenuity.
